Demarius Bolds (born May 6, 1984) is an American professional basketball player for Kymis of the Greek Basket League. Standing at 1.93 m (6'4"), he plays the shooting guard position. After two years at Missouri Western State University, Bolds entered the 2006 NBA draft but was not selected in the draft's two rounds.

High school career

Bolds played high school basketball at Cahokia High School, in Cahokia, Illinois.

College career

Bolds played college basketball for the Missouri Western Griffons from 2004 to 2006.

Playing career

On October 3, 2014, Bolds joined Nift Al-Janoub from Iraq.[1] On February 23, 2015, Bolds left Nift Al-Janoub and joined Al Rayyan of the Qatari Basketball League.[2]

He started the 2015-16 season with Final Gençlik. On December 10, 2015, he signed with Greek team Lavrio.[3] He went on to average 15.9 points, 3.7 rebounds, 1.6 assists and 1.5 steals in 16 games for Lavrio. On April, 10, 2016, he signed with Sagesse for the remainder of the season.[4]

On June, 19, 2016, Bolds returned to Lavrio, renewing his contract for one more year.[5]

On August 17, 2017, Bolds joined Al Mouttahed Tripoli of the Lebanese Basketball League.[6] On March 27, 2018, Bolds left Al Mouttahed and joined Al Wakrah of the Qatari Basketball League.[7] He finished the season in Bahrain with Al Muharraq.

On July 10, 2018 he joined Kymis of the Greek Basket League.[8]
